What is goods services bulletin
The Goods & Services Bulletin is a government publication used by Massachusetts state agencies to detail procurement opportunities for goods and services.

What is the Goods & Services Bulletin?
The Goods & Services Bulletin is a vital resource for procurement opportunities in Massachusetts. This bulletin plays a crucial role in providing bid invitations and contract information for goods and services, specifically targeting state agencies and businesses keen on participating in the bidding process. By utilizing the massachusetts procurement bulletin, interested parties can access timely and detailed procurement information necessary for making informed decisions.

Key Features of the Goods & Services Bulletin
This bulletin includes essential elements such as bid invitations, specifications, and detailed submission instructions. Key fields included within the form, such as DEPT. CODE, AGENCY NAME, and CONTACT EMAIL, are vital for ensuring accurate and complete applications. Users can take advantage of weekly publications to remain up-to-date regarding new opportunities listed in the massachusetts procurement bulletin.

Who is eligible to use the Goods & Services Bulletin?
Any state agency in Massachusetts and vendors interested in government contracts can utilize the Goods & Services Bulletin to find procurement opportunities.
Are there any deadlines for submitting bids through this bulletin?
Yes, deadlines vary by specific bids listed in the Goods & Services Bulletin. Check each bid invitation for submission due dates.

Can I access previous bulletins?
Yes, prior issues of the Goods & Services Bulletin may be accessible through the Massachusetts Secretary of the Commonwealth’s website or archives.
